Impact of health belief on self-efficacy for postoperative rehabilitation management in lung cancer patients: the Chain mediating role of respiratory exercise compliance and symptom burden
2024-07-26
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p>Background Self-efficacy for postoperative rehabilitation management is the key to rapid recovery after lung cancer surgery. Identification of protective and risk factors is a prerequisite for programs to enhance self-efficacy.
